Woolamai Beach is a popular spot on Phillip Island, located in the state of Victoria. It is known for its long, sandy beach and consistent waves, making it a great destination for intermediate surfers. If you're planning to go to Woolamai Beach during the winter, here are some things you should know:
1.
Best Surf Conditions: this beach is known for its consistent surf, with waves ranging from 2 to 6 feet. The best time to catch the wave is from June to August, when they are more powerful.
2. Surfing Level: it is suitable for intermediate level who have experience with larger waves and are comfortable navigating rip currents. It's important to be aware of your skill level and not push yourself too hard, as the currents can be strong.
3. Etiquette: it's important to follow the rules to ensure everyone's safety and enjoyment. This includes respecting the local sportsmen, not dropping in on someone's wave, and not hogging the waves.
4. Gear: Make sure to bring appropriate gear for winter temperatures, including a wetsuit (ideally 4/3 mm thickness), booties, and a hood if the water is particularly cold.
5. Safety: Always check the weather and surf conditions before heading out and never ride alone. It's also a good idea to familiarize yourself with the beach and its currents before getting in the water.
